; ----------------------------------------------------------------------- ; : RPFNAMES.INC - include datoteka za projekt RP : ; : (C) 26.11.1990 Leon Kos, Cerknica cesta 4.maja 11a : ; ----------------------------------------------------------------------- ; ;imena funkcij za video bios in bios ;VIDEO BIOS funkcije ; PO_CHAR EQU 00h ; Izpi{e ~rko v A SCRL EQU 01h ; premakne levo stran A SCRR EQU 02h ; premakne desno stran A SCRUP EQU 03h ; premik navzdol A SCRDN EQU 04h ; premik navzgor A FILLPAGE EQU 05h ; zapolni stran A z B registrom CLRPAGES EQU 06h ; bri{e vse video strani CPYB2A EQU 07h ; kopira B v A stran CPLPAGE EQU 08h ; naredi koplement A strani SETDPAGE EQU 09h ; izbere A aktivno stran za displaya PO_TESTIRANJE EQU 0Ah ; izpi{e Testiranje.. LOADROMFONT EQU 0Bh ; nastavi video kontroler VDELAY EQU 0Ch ; zakasnitev A*ms, ali B*0.1s ~e A==0 POTTY EQU 0Dh ; TTY izpis A=loptr,B=hiptr POTIME EQU 0Eh ; Izpis ~asa na stran A PODATE EQU 0Fh ; Izpis datuma na stran A SETRTC EQU 10h ; nastavi RTC SETTIME EQU 11h ; nastavi RTC ~as SETDATE EQU 12h ; nastavi RTC datum SETDAY EQU 13h ; Nastavi dan v tednu SHIFTUP EQU 14h ; pomik strani A navzgor SHIFTDN EQU 15h ; pomik strani A navzdol POAHEX EQU 16h ; izpis A registra na aktivno stran HEX POAASC EQU 17h ; izpis A registra na aktivno stran ASCII SHIFTL EQU 18h ; pomik strani levo SHIFTR EQU 19h ; pomik strani desno POSTR EQU 1Ah ; izpis DE stringa na stran A FLASH EQU 1Bh ; utripne A stran s pomo~jo B strani POERROR EQU 1Ch ; izpis napake, BA=kazalec na string MOVELEFT EQU 1Dh ; pomakne v levo za cel display s hitrostjo TTY CURSOR EQU 1Eh ; izpis kurzorja na aktivno stran A=pozicija GOTOX EQU 1Fh ; nastavi cilj za izpis ~rke stran B, poz A VBIOS MACRO funkcija rst 20h DEFB funkcija ENDM